Different Welder’s Qualifications

Although the American Welding Society’s normal CW (Certified Welder) credential paves the way for the majority of work opportunities, many industries call for their own specific certification. Examples of the most-popular of which are listed below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als that work with boiler and pressure containers
  • Certified Welder Credentials to be a Certified Welder
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ders who work on pipelines in the energy field
  • SCWI and CWI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ors

Job and Wage

Job Growth Outlook for Welding Specialists in South Windsor CT

According to the O*Net Online, welders are highly in demand in the State of Connecticut. The increase in new jobs for welders are predicted to go up nationally by the year 2022 and in Connecticut. Regardless of whether your goal is to work within the welding field, there has never been a better time to be a welder in South Windsor CT.

The below data illustrates jobs and salary forecasts for welding professionals in Connecticut through the end of the decade.

Connecticut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 2,210 2,290 3% 60
Connecticut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$28,200 $39,900 $61,500

Source: O*Net Online

A Look Inside Welding Specialist Programs

The following hints should help assist you in choosing which welding schools are the ideal match for your situation. It may feel like there are lots of welding specialist training in South Windsor CT, but you still have to select the program that will best lead you to your long-term aspirations. Before anything else, find out if the program is recognized or certified through the AWS. A number of other topics you may want to consider aside from accreditation may include:

  • Make certain the program teaches on technology that suits the latest industry guidelines
  • Determine if the facility gives financial aid
  • Make certain the school’s program provides classes in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Find programs that fulfill AWS SENSE standards
